Décor Projects that Make Use of Household Items

Updating your home doesn’t have to result in a lot of expense. Here are some great things you can do with items that are lying around the house.

Old Boots are Charming Vases

If you don’t like that old pair of boots anymore, why not turn it into a vase for flowers? Simply line the inside of the boots with wax paper and fill three-quarters of them with potting soil. Plant a flower and then fill the rest of the boots with more potting soil. Remember to add a dash of water!

Ladder is an Instant Towel Rack

Ladders can be used around the house as décor items. Use one as a towel rack in the bathroom, for example. This is a great tip if your bathroom is small because it offers a place to hang towels without taking much space.

Stack Suitcases to Create a Vintage Look

Suitcases are usually packed away when you’re not in need of them, but you can use them around the house as décor items. They could be piled up and used as the perfect spot for a vase or tray. You could even store them under the coffee table to fill the space: they look fun, especially if they’re a vintage style or come in a vibrant color, while being a sneaky place to store your magazines and books.
